This website and the forum have come from an idea that I was discussing with some other cyclists about forming a cycling club for beginners, specifically ladies. The original idea stated:

"I'm thinking of starting a local cycling club. It would be a club for ladies only, primarily aimed at beginners, in a sort of sight-seeing-and-cycling kind of format (lots of tea shops and pubs!), to enable Village Ladies (it's sounding farcical already!!) to go out in company at nights and to organise some fun trips. It would be emphatically not for racing, or for huge mile-eating rides. Yes, you're right, I need some cycling buddies!! But then isn't that how they all start?"

One suggestion that came up was that it would be nice to also operate some kind of contact network also, so that any ladies anywhere that were beginning to (or were thinking about) returning to cycling could get together.

I was, of course, very keen, being a beginner myself, and spent quite a lot of time finding out what I needed to know about the implications of setting up a club.  The issue I found is that it's expensive.  It's expensive mainly because of the insurance and procedures that need to be followed to protect against possible litigation that may be levied against me, as an "organiser".

Well gosh!  If it's going to be so expensive and risky, no wonder nobody does it.  The easy way to circumvent all of this red tape is for me to, ostensibly, not organise anything.  We can all just get together, get to know each other, and ride out to nice places at a mutually decided date and time, with all of us bearing the responsibility for our own safety. 

Hence the forum.

So!  All of the lady cyclists out there who are interested in getting to know other lady cyclists in your area, who are beginners intimidated by the long mileage and speeds of "normal" cycling clubs, or who just fancy regular rides to nice places with lots of stops and opportunities to explore the area being travelled through, join the forum and we'll see what we can put together!
